So, I agree with you on the palette by Mother Pat. Where I started to get lost- was the complaint about lack of lighter transition shades. Perhaps, this is the difference between a makeup reviewer and a professional makeup artist? All that you need to do to achieve a wide range of lighter shades is to mix a dark matte with a lighter shade. Also- if you use the correct eyeshadow brush? You can blend out any dark shade… practically to nothing. In specific- the Viseart palette- even the dark matte shades will blend out to be a wisp of the original shade. That’s why a lot of current palettes don’t have the need for a variety of light matte shades. 🤷♀️
The thing about Pat mattes is as well that you can create different depths with the same eyeshadow. Dip once and you have a light wash of colour, dip twice, a stronger colour and then you can build it up to reflect the shade in the pan.

I think you should consider the use of smudged liners to morph the color of shadows if you want something darker or lighter. Also consider layering a couple shadow shades to create different colors. Layering a couple of the Pat McGrath browns for depth, for example. A lot of those darker shades are actually color switches. Instead of thinking of only the usual it’s a “transition shade” that’s too dark for me think of different techniques. I rarely use that method, but I love blending to create colors. You can blend out a deeper shimmer where you isn’t normally put a darker matte. If you only apply your shadows in one way, you’re limiting yourself.
